Description
The City of Bradford Metropolitan District Council wishes to inform organisations of its plans for publishing a tender for Mental Health Wellbeing Service, a short term intervention for adults experiencing mental ill health.
Bradford Council's Health and Wellbeing department, along with its strategic partners, has seen the health and social care system align with a single ambition for people in the district: Happy, Healthy and at Home.
We are looking for providers who will work with people with mental ill health to promote independence, social inclusion, choice, and to reduce barriers to life by empowering, encouraging and supporting them to take a full part in their pathway to recovery.
We will be holding market engagement events for Providers on:
• Tuesday 22nd March 9 am - 12 noon
with the intention of publishing the tender in May 2022.
